Why Sell Your House Fast for Cash?

  1. Speed of Transaction
    One of the primary reasons homeowners opt to sell their house for cash is the speed of the transaction. Unlike traditional home sales, which can take weeks or even months, cash sales can close in as little as a week. This is particularly advantageous for those who need to relocate quickly or resolve financial issues. The swift nature of cash sales allows you to move forward without the prolonged stress often associated with selling a home.
  2. No Repairs Needed
    Selling a house traditionally often requires significant repairs and renovations to attract buyers and maximize sale price. However, when you sell for cash, many buyers purchase properties “as-is,” meaning you won’t need to invest time or money in repairs. This can save you thousands of dollars and alleviate the burden of coordinating contractors and home improvements.
  3. Fewer Complications
    Traditional sales come with numerous complications—buyer financing may fall through, lengthy negotiations can ensue, and inspections can lead to disputes. Cash buyers typically offer simpler agreements with fewer contingencies, meaning there’s a lower chance of the sale falling through at the last minute. This streamlined process helps eliminate much of the stress associated with home selling.
  4. Avoiding Realtor Commissions
    When selling a house through a real estate agent, homeowners often pay a commission of around 5-6% of the sale price. Selling your home for cash can allow you to bypass these fees, keeping more of your money in your pocket. While cash offers may be slightly lower than traditional market offers, the savings from avoiding commissions and potential repairs can make this option financially appealing.
  5. Certainty and Peace of Mind
    Cash buyers provide certainty that can be reassuring during what can often be a tumultuous time. Knowing that your buyer has the funds available to complete the purchase means you can plan your next steps with confidence, reducing the anxiety that often accompanies selling a home.

The Process of Selling Your House Fast for Cash

  1. Research Cash Buyers
    Start by researching potential cash buyers in your area. These could be individual investors, real estate investment firms, or companies specializing in buying homes for cash. Look for reputable buyers with positive reviews and testimonials to ensure you’re working with trustworthy individuals.
  2. Initial Contact
    Once you’ve identified a few cash buyers, reach out to them. Many buyers have online forms or phone numbers where you can provide basic information about your property. Be prepared to share details about its size, location, condition, and any unique features that may affect its value.
  3. Receive a Cash Offer
    After reviewing your information, the cash buyer will likely schedule a visit to assess the property and provide you with a cash offer. While cash offers can be lower than the market value, they reflect the convenience and speed of the transaction. You can choose to accept, negotiate, or decline the offer based on your circumstances.
  4. Evaluate the Offer
    Carefully evaluate the cash offer presented to you. Consider not only the price but also the closing timeline and any conditions attached to the offer. If you’re comfortable with the terms, you can accept the offer; if not, don’t hesitate to negotiate.
  5. Closing the Sale
    If you accept the offer, you will enter the closing process. Cash buyers often have a streamlined process, allowing for a quick closing—sometimes within a week. You’ll sign the necessary paperwork, transfer ownership, and receive your cash payment.

Tips for a Successful Cash Sale

  • Be Honest About Your Home’s Condition: Transparency is key when dealing with cash buyers. Disclose any issues or repairs needed upfront to avoid complications later in the process. This honesty builds trust and leads to smoother negotiations.
  • Get Multiple Offers: Don’t settle for the first offer you receive. Shopping around and obtaining offers from multiple cash buyers can give you leverage in negotiations and help you find the best deal for your home.
